package net.contextfw.web.application.internal.util;
import static org.junit.Assert.assertEquals;
import static org.junit.Assert.assertNotNull;
import static org.junit.Assert.assertTrue;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import java.util.HashSet;
import java.util.List;
import java.util.Set;
import net.contextfw.web.application.component.Component;
import net.contextfw.web.application.lifecycle.AfterBuild;
import net.contextfw.web.application.remote.Remoted;
import org.junit.Test;
public class ClassScannerTest {
public static class A {
}
public abstract static class B<T> extends Component {
@Remoted
public void b(T t, A a, Long c) {};
}
public static class C extends B<A> {}
@Test
public void testClassScanning() {
List<Class<?>> classes = ClassScanner.getClasses(
"net.contextfw.web.application.internal.util",
"net.contextfw.web.application.lifecycle");
Set<Class<?>> clsSet = new HashSet<Class<?>>();
clsSet.addAll(classes);
assertTrue(clsSet.contains(ClassScannerTest.class));
assertTrue(clsSet.contains(ResourceScannerTest.class));
assertTrue(clsSet.contains(ClassScanner.class));
assertTrue(clsSet.contains(ResourceScanner.class));
assertTrue(clsSet.contains(AfterBuild.class));
}
@Test
public void Get_Type_Parameters_For_B() throws IllegalArgumentException, IllegalAccessException, InvocationTargetException {
B<A> b = new B<A>() {
@Override
public void b(A t, A a, Long c) {
System.out.println("Invoked");
}
};
Method method = ClassScanner.findMethodForName(b.getClass(), "b");
assertNotNull("Method", method);
A a = new A();
List<Class<?>> types = ClassScanner.getParamTypes(b.getClass(), method);
assertEquals(3, types.size());
assertEquals(A.class, types.get(0));
assertEquals(A.class, types.get(1));
assertEquals(Long.class, types.get(2));
method.invoke(b, new Object[] {a, a, 0L});
}
@Test
public void Get_Type_Parameters_For_C() throws IllegalArgumentException, IllegalAccessException, InvocationTargetException {
C c = new C();
Method method = ClassScanner.findMethodForName(c.getClass(), "b");
assertNotNull("Method", method);
A a = new A();
List<Class<?>> types = ClassScanner.getParamTypes(c.getClass(), method);
assertEquals(3, types.size());
assertEquals(A.class, types.get(0));
assertEquals(A.class, types.get(1));
assertEquals(Long.class, types.get(2));
method.invoke(c, new Object[] {a, a, 0L});
}
}
